What are the organization's current programs, how do they measure success, and who do the programs serve?
Aidmatnx Network
Business Week said in December, 2004, "the programs may be virtual, but the results are real." Aidmatrix's programs include Hunger Relief, Medical / Disaster Relief, General Humanitarian Aid, Donations / Inventory Management, and Virtual Aid Drives including the Virtual Food Drive. Computerworld said of Aidmatrix leveraging of technology to achieve good for humankind that it "is a model for the future rather than an icon of the past." Aidmatrix partners with renowned organizations including America's Second Harvest, Share Our Strength, the United Nations World Food Programme, and the European Federation of Food Banks (FEBA). Over 150 food banks have benefited from Aidmatrix solutions, with more than 750 million pounds of donated food having passed through the system since July of 2001. In addition, leading food manufacturers such as Kraft, Conagra, Tyson, Coca Cola, Tropicana, SunSweet, Welch's, and Barilla, as well as restaurant chain Olive Garden, use Aidmatrix to manage their in-kind donations that feed the hungry. Aidmatrix recently signed MOUs with American Red Cross and International Federation of the Red Cross and is in the second phase of a product donation partnership with FedEx/Kinkos.

What is the organization aiming to accomplish?
Support the delivery of $1Billion in aid each year.
Support 75,000 organizations.
Impact 75 Million people each year
What are the organization's key strategies for making this happen?
Produce technologies that are highly leverage-able.
Work with high impact networks and partners.
Deliver with excellence.
Incorporate sustainability into each program.
What are the organization's capabilities for doing this?
Aidmatrix Foundation's core capabilities are in Cloud Based Technologies, Humanitarian Supply Chain Solutions, Managed Services &
Education Services.
What have they accomplished so far and what's next?
Over $1 Billion in aid delivered each year
Over 50,000 organizations
Over 55 million people impacted each year
